We have presented the technological scheme of a dispersal device which allows to increase the efficiency of cleaning and disinfection of automotive vans with specialized solutions
For cleaning and disinfection of motor vans we can effectively apply installation for the treatment of work surfaces with a disinfectant spray. Disinfection unit is a generator of hot mist with a device for
dispersing
The effectiveness of disinfection depends on used disinfecting materials for vans, their actions and technological parameters of the installation for applying disinfectants. Hot mist generators provide uniform distribution of particles of disinfectant solution inside the van for transportation of agricultural products. The parameters of the generator of hot mist affecting the quality of disinfection were investigated. Tests were conducted for the vans used to transport agricultural products. For studies we used the vans in operation, which transport farm animals (pigs) and had been disinfected before. Sampling for the research on contamination was performed with pre-prepared swabs. Factorial experiment was planned with using scheme #32, and as a result of significant factors in the univariate experiments we set a temperature of the aerosol disinfectant solution and the duration of surface treatment. As an optimization function we have chosen disinfection efficiency of bodies of vehicles carrying agricultural products. Comparing the results of the experiments on different groups of microorganisms we have found that the optimal mode of hot mist generator with a dispersing device are: the processing time of 1 m2 - 8.5 at the processing temperature - 65º C
One can see some density irregularity within the roll
in the baler with a chamber of constant volume. We
have found out that the maximum density of hay roll
width (the baler width) is observed in the middle part.
This is due to the shape of the hay roll entering the
baler. To even the hay rolls they have mounted some
rotating disks having some inclined spring pins above
the baler. To improve the roller distribution the disks
above the baler have been pushed forward forming a
tapering gap. The evening discs rotating above the
moving roll will cause some relative motion of hay
particles. The interaction of the evening disks with
the hay roll in the vertical plane will be determined
by the elasticity of the hay roll and the weight of the
frame with the disks. We have studied the trajectories
of hay particles motion with the help of MathCad
program. We have had the following initial
parameters: the degree of compaction (decrease of the
roll height when evening), the friction coefficient, the
angle rate of the evening disks, the number of pins and the speed of the hay roll. As a result we have got
the trajectories of the hay particles motion when the
evening disks functioning. The analysis of the
trajectories has allowed to establish some basic
parameters of the evening device such as the distance
of 0.15…0.2 m between the pins; the degree of
compression while evening 20...25 %, the angle rate
of the evening discs 23...30 rad / s and the diameter
of the evening disc 0.74 m. The application of the
evening device in the form of the disks with pins
provides a uniform distribution of hay particles
edgewise of the baler ensuring preliminary hay roll
seal press before passing to the baler pressure
chamber that contributes to getting the rolls with
larger mass and a uniform distribution of hay density
inside the roll
Potato is cultivated in 130 countries on an area of over
18 million hectares; it annually gives more than 300
million tons of tubers. The share of the Russian
Federation accounts is about 11% ... 14% of total
production. The resulting potatoes consumed in food, animal feed, technical purposes, seed fund. According
to the Ministry of agriculture of Russia, the largest
number of potatoes in our country (89 %) is produced in
peasant farms and personal farms of citizens, the area of
cultivation of which make up about 2.7 million hectares.
At such farms for the harvest, they use mainly potatodiggers,
followed by selection of crops manually. The
use of diggers in small areas of planting is more costefficiently
in relation to the harvesting combine. In
addition, the parameters requested for ATT to damage
potatoes when harvesting with the diggers (3%) are
higher than during harvesting by combine harvester
(5%). As practice shows, for the use of cleaning units,
even under optimal harvesting conditions in the hopper
of the combine, there are soil and vegetable impurities.
There are many different devices intended to localize
the problem. Based on the foregoing, we can conclude
that it is necessary to pay considerable attention to the
quality of work of excavating working bodies, because
it affects the productivity of the functioning of the
whole machine. Currently, there are widespread potato
aggregates with the receiving part, equipped with side
disks, spaced along the edges of the plowshares. The
disks cut off the raised layer of soil from between the
rows. This entails improving the performance of the
potato harvester. The most efficient and economical
from the point of view of energy consumption, is the
work of passive disks with hooks. The quality of potato
harvesters depends on the design and performance of
excavating bodies. The proposed design solution for an
excavating body increases the productivity of harvesting
machines

Due to the deterioration of the ecological situation
in the world, population tends to eat organically
grown foods that are grown either without or with
minimal use of chemicals. The development of
agriculture in this direction leads ultimately to
organic agriculture. To improve the competitiveness of this direction, we need more
effective agricultural machines, especially in the
last phase of cultivation, namely at the stage of
harvesting. One of the most difficult scientific and
technical problems with the mechanical harvesting
of potatoes is not letting vegetable impurities and
tops to fall down in the hopper with the potato
tubers, which among other things will improve
operational efficiency technology. The article
reviewed the various methods for removing the
tops, as well as their advantages and disadvantages.
The article makes a conclusion about the need for
potato top separators in harvesting machines. We
have also considered a promising device for
removing haulm, a conveyor with flexible fingers
on the bars and the clamping beater. Тhe most
short-lived structural element of the device for
removing haulm, reducing reliability of the device,
is flexible fingers mounted on rods. We have
proposed to use polyurethane as a material for
manufacturing flexible fingers
In recent years, in many countries around the
world, much attention is paid to the issues of
ensuring of rational use of energy resources,
due to a number of objective factors, chief
among which are: the lack of own energy
resources to meet domestic energy needs; the
sharp increase in the cost of production and the
production of energy resources; further growth
in energy needs; the presence of large potential
opportunities to reduce unproductive losses of
fuel and energy. In the world, the challenge
now is to ensure a gradual but steady transfer of
the economy on energy saving way of
development. To achieve the goal of reducing
energy costs we might use two ways: firstly, the
widespread introduction of energy saving
technologies, and secondly, the reduction of
material production, improving its quality and
service. In agriculture, the improvement of the
technological process can be carried out using
new tillage methods, improving the
organization of production and tools. Further
development of mechanization in agriculture
will contribute to further growth of
electrification in the agricultural sector, which
will significantly reduce the use of the most
expensive and limited energy resources. The
article offers a technique of the estimation of
the efficiency of consumption of energy in
agricultural production. In order to compare the
efficiency of machines in the cultivation and
harvesting of potatoes, there was conducted an
energy assessment of the operations of modern
technology. As variables, there were
investigated different operation modes of the
machine: working speed and working width,
depth of stroke of the working bodies. In the
process of evaluating energy operations,
modern technology to prepare the soil for
planting potatoes was determined humidity,
mechanical composition and soil type. As a
main factor in the analysis of technological
methods, we have taken the overall specific
energy consumption and specific energy
consumption for the digging below tuber
formation. Analysis of theoretical researches of
agricultural machinery has led to the conclusion
that the energy cost of implementing the
technological process in the machines of
different designs varies
